Time Out says

Author and Skidmore professor Daniel Swift (Bomber County: The Poetry of a Lost Pilot's War) looks at the literary responses of writers—such as Dylan Thomas and Virginia Woolf—to the horrors they witnessed during World War II. In the cases of Thomas and Woolf, the traumatic German blitz reduced much of their environs to rubble.
